The cheapest way to get from Lebanon to Corvallis is to fly and bus and train which costs $420 - $1,400 and takes 26h 28m.
The fastest way to get from Lebanon to Corvallis is to fly and bus which takes 22h 36m and costs $420 - $1,400.
The distance between Lebanon and Corvallis is 6970 miles.
It takes approximately 22h 36m to get from Lebanon to Corvallis, including transfers.
Corvallis is 10h behind Lebanon. It is currently 4:19 AM in Lebanon and 6:19 PM in Corvallis.

There is no direct connection from Lebanon to Corvallis. However, you can take the taxi to Beirut International Airport (BEY) airport, fly to Mahlon Sweet Field Airport (EUG), walk to Eugene Airport, then take the bus to Corvallis Downtown. Alternatively, you can take the taxi to Beirut International Airport (BEY) airport, fly to Portland International Airport (PDX), walk to Portland International Airport, then take the bus to Corvallis: Courtyard by Marriott.
